/*
* Facilities for cross-processor subroutine calls using "mailbox" interrupts.
*/
#include <sys/types.h>
#include <sys/thread.h>
#include <sys/cpuvar.h>
#include <sys/x_call.h>
#include <sys/systm.h>
#include <sys/machsystm.h>
#include <sys/intr.h>
/*
* Interrupt another CPU.
* This is useful to make the other CPU go through a trap so that
* it recognizes an address space trap (AST) for preempting a thread.
*
* It is possible to be preempted here and be resumed on the CPU
* being poked, so it isn't an error to poke the current CPU.
* We could check this and still get preempted after the check, so
* we don't bother.
*/
void
poke_cpu(int cpun)
{
uint32_t *ptr = (uint32_t *)&cpu[cpun]->cpu_m.poke_cpu_outstanding;
/*
* If panicstr is set or a poke_cpu is already pending,
* no need to send another one. Use atomic swap to protect
* against multiple CPUs sending redundant pokes.
*/
if (panicstr || *ptr == B_TRUE ||
atomic_swap_32(ptr, B_TRUE) == B_TRUE)
return;
xt_one(cpun, setsoftint_tl1, poke_cpu_inum, 0);
}
